Learning English

Studying diligently by flickr user scui3asteveo

The process of learning a new language can be challenging because of the intricacies involved. However, alternative ways of teaching English come in handy to make it easy and enjoyable. To speak English and also write it well, the foundation you get as a learner determines your final command of the language itself. The Lexical [...]